David Gemmell
English author of fantasy novels
English author of fantasy novels
An English author wrote prominent fantasy novels. Worked as a journalist and later became known for crafting heroic fantasy literature. Early works, including 'Legend' and 'Waylander,' garnered a dedicated following. Many novels featured recurring themes of heroism, sacrifice, and moral dilemmas. The author's style blended action with rich character development, influencing the genre significantly. Continued to write until passing away in 2006, leaving a substantial legacy in fantasy literature.
Authored 'Legend' and 'Waylander'
Wrote the Drenai Saga series
